Mr. Michael and Mr. Eric
The Learning Groove is created and presented by Mr. Eric and Mr. Michael, award-winning performers, music producers and educators. Mr. Eric and Mr. Michael have over twenty years of experience in early childhood music and education. Mr. Eric (AKA Eric Litwin)is a guitar-strumming, song-singing, banjo-picking, tale-telling, song-writing, five time national-award-winning, two-hundred-performances-a-year-giving, CD-producing, folksy fun type of guy. Eric holds two masters degrees including an MA in education. He is also a popular member of Young Audiences at Woodruff Arts Center and has given keynotes across the country on music in the classroom. Mr. Eric has produced two award-winning children’s CDs, “Smile at Your Neighbor” and “The Big Silly,” and his first picture book, “Pete the Cat, I Love My White Shoes,” was published in July 2008. Learn more about Mr. Eric at www.ericlitwin.com. Mr. Michael (AKA Michael Levine)has become one of Atlanta’s most popular performers and teachers of children’s music. He has over fifteen years experience as a song leader and music teacher at schools, camps and music programs. After graduating from the University of Virginia with a B.A. in Music in 1994, he spent several years as a singer-songwriter, opening for such acts as Dave Matthews Band, Counting Crows, Joe Walsh, and many more. Mr. Michael is also a popular performer with Young Audiences at Woodruff Arts Center. He is an exceptional teacher trainer as well as a national-award-winning record producer of children’s music.
